Transaction 14982de307eed0238362ee067e887e781be6c1927d518b8381ddbd351ed587f2
1 Input
1 Output
-
14982de307eed0238362ee067e887e781be6c1927d518b8381ddbd351ed587f2:0
- value
- 646630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eee2bb66b870b4cc4e5683490cde168b4548e119 OP_EQUAL
- address
- 3PU8MpN8piZGXp3wAjwmUDkmWmBjudNBNx